CVE-2015-4668 describes an open redirect vulnerability in Xsuite versions 2.4.4.5 and earlier, allowing attackers to redirect users to arbitrary malicious websites. With a CVSS score of 6.1 (Medium), this vulnerability can be exploited remotely with low complexity, requiring user interaction, to facilitate phishing attacks and potentially compromise user data. While not actively exploited in the wild (no KEV entry), public exploit code exists on ExploitDB and Nuclei templates are available, indicating a clear path for exploitation.
